The Hungarian League Cup (Hungarian: Magyar Ligakupa) was an annual football tournament contested by clubs in the Hungarian League. It was created in 2007 and the competition only lasted for 8 seasons, being cancelled in 2015/2016.

Ligakupa finals

The performance of various clubs is shown in the following table:[1]

Season Winner Score Runner-up
2007–08 Videoton 1–0 / 2–0 Debrecen
2008–09 Videoton 3–1 Pécsi FC
2009–10 Debrecen 2–1 Paks
2010–11 Paks 1–2 / 3–0 Debrecen
2011–12 Videoton 3–0 Kecskemét
2012–13 Ferencváros 5–1 Videoton
2013–14 Diósgyőr 2–1 Videoton
2014–15 Ferencváros 2-1 Debrecen
